Scania AXL Autonomous Truck Concept Ditches Manual Controls
Curated from www.digitaltrends.com - September 26th, 2019 by RobotShop

The Scania AXL concept is a heavy duty truck that doesn't even have room onboard for a human driver. The autonomous truck was designed to work at construction sites and mines. Scania is currently testing autonomous trucks in the field, but with human safety drivers onboard.

Top 5 countries using industrial robots in 2018: IFR
Curated from www.therobotreport.com - September 20th, 2019 by RobotShop

The IFR said 422,000 industrial robots were shipped worldwide in 2018, a 6 percent increase. These five countries led the growth of industrial robots.
